> Before changing the red_worker to use the red_channel interface, there
> was a devoted red_pipe_clear routine for the display channel and cursor channel.
> However, clearing the pipe in red_channel, uses the release_item callback
> the worker provided. This callback has handled only resources that need to be released
> after the pipe item was enqueued from the pipe, and only for pipe items that were set in
> red_channel_init_send_data.
> This fix changes the display channel release_item callback to handle all types of
> pipe items, and also handles differently pushed and non-pushed pipe items.
